Discover the wonders of Science City

Science City in Kolkata is a beautifully constructed venue that has taken into mind sustainable and eco-friendly construction methods. It is an uncommon choice, but one that undoubtedly offers a fun-filled experience. This makes sure that everyone who comes here has a good experience, especially the kids. Along with brushing up on your understanding of scientific ideas and experiments, there is plenty here to keep you occupied.

Entry fees: INR 50/- per person

Timings: 9:00 AM to 7:00 PM

Visit Princep Ghat on Holly and go boating

This location is among the most well-liked in Kolkata and for all the proper factors. Princep Ghat, a British-era structure built near the banks of the well-known Hoogly River, is a treat for travellers to find. Due to the location’s unspoilt attractiveness, it is also a locals’ favourite. The bustling Princep Ghat, which offers breathtaking river views, is the ideal location to take advantage of all that Kolkata is known for, including fantastic food, shopping and boating. Since the area is crowded with tourists, you might have to wait a little longer for a boat trip, but it is worth it.

Timings: Open 24/7, however, the best times to go are at sunrise or sunset

Go on a Tram ride

Even though it is a bit kitschy and retro if you do not take a tram ride while you are in Kolkata, did you ever go there? Let’s face it, the thought of boarding a tram and exploring the city’s historical beauties is a traveller’s dream. You can board a tram at Esplanade and ride it to the end or decide to get off halfway to travel somewhere else. Choose the afternoon for this excursion because the tram can get quite packed; otherwise, you risk missing the experience of the morning rush.

Visit Nicco Park to relive your youth

Often referred to as the Disneyland of Kolkata, Nicco Park is a sizable, environmentally friendly area with many rides. The rides are truly spectacular and transport you right back to your carefree childhood.

Entry fees: Rs 200 onwards

Time: 10:30 AM to 7:30 PM
